Zelensky recalls Ukrainian personnel from peacekeeping forces
President of Ukraine Volodymyr Zelensky signed a decree on the withdrawal of Ukrainian contingents that take part in international peacekeeping operations.
"In connection with the armed aggression of the Russian Federation against Ukraine in order to protect the sovereignty and territorial integrity of the state, I decided to withdraw the national contingent and national personnel who take part in international peace and security operations to Ukraine in order to participate in the defense of sovereignty and territorial integrity of the state," the decree reads, a photocopy of which was posted on Facebook by Deputy Head of the President's Office Andriy Sybiha on Monday.
